China to build new giant panda breeding base to save sub-species
AFP, October, 2005
BEIJING (AFP) — China is to set up a new breeding base for a special species of giant pandas in its latest bid to save the undersexed endangered animal from extinction.
The base would research into the breeding of a species of giant pandas unique to Qinling Mountains in northern China's Shaanxi province and oversee their release into the wild, Xinhua news agency reported Monday.
